Properties
Description
PLGA-PEG-glucose materials combine biodegradable copolymers with PEGylated glucose through covalent bonds from plant starch processing, creating sustainable drug carriers with controlled release properties.
Source
Chemical synthesis
Functional Group
PLGA
Form
Solid or powder
Purity
≥95%
Impurities
No visible impurities to the naked eye.
Solubility
This product is soluble in most organic solvents, such as DCM, DMF, DMSO, and THF, and exhibits excellent solubility in water.
Identity
Confirmed by NMR.
Applications
Glucose-PEG-poly(lactic-co-glycolic acid) can be used for its potential to develop PLGA-PEG carriers for sustained release profile characterization.
